About Arganzuela
Arganzuela strikes a great balance between urban energy and places to unwind, which is why it has become one of Madrid’s most appealing areas to live. Its standout feature is Madrid Río, a green corridor that’s perfect for walking, running, or cycling, with open views and a very family-friendly vibe. Add to that Matadero Madrid, a bold, creative cultural hub that offers exhibitions, events, and fresh plans throughout the year.
Neighbourhoods like Acacias and Legazpi are known for their everyday comfort: residential streets, parks close by, and quick access to the city centre. Legazpi station (Lines 3 and 6) makes getting around easy, and the area feels lively without the intensity of the tourist core.
Food-wise, Arganzuela has an authentic charm—traditional bars sit naturally alongside more modern spots. Places like Casa Mingo, famous for its cider and roast chicken, are part of the local identity. Families also benefit from schools such as Colegio San Javier, and having Hospital 12 de Octubre nearby adds extra peace of mind. Overall, Arganzuela is ideal if you want nature within the city, strong connections, and a dynamic yet well-balanced Madrid lifestyle.

Are utilities included in the rental price (water, electricity, and gas)?
Utilities ARE NOT INCLUDED in the apartment rental price. We work with an approximate monthly provision based on the size of the flat:
- 1-bedroom apartment: approx. 150 €/month*
- 2-bedroom apartment: approx. 200 €/month*
- 3-bedroom apartment: approx. 250 €/month*
- 4+ bedroom apartment: approx. 300 €/month*
*Reference values. Always check with your agent for the exact amount in each case.
This provision is paid along with the monthly rent within the first 5 days of each month. If, during the stay, consumption is found to be significantly higher than estimated, you will be informed of the difference.
In some apartments, utilities may be paid via a fixed monthly fee. We will inform you if this applies to your case.
What type of insurance does the property have?
Most of our properties have multi-risk insurance (building and, in many cases, contents) which covers:
- Structural elements of the home.
- Installations and, in some cases, part of the furniture.
This insurance DOES NOT cover your personal belongings (computers, phones, suitcases, etc.).
Therefore, we recommend that you consider taking out a tenant's home insurance or travel insurance that includes coverage for personal belongings during your stay.
